    Um...

    I don't buy it. Yes, the Titans played some DE's at DT to try and get more pass rush, but Kearse has put on more pressure than KVB has and we need our best pass rushing DE's to play. Ask yourself, who would have a bigger impact on stopping the Colts...Senderrick Marks or Jevon Kearse? If you already have TBrown, Haye, Vickerson at DT PLUS are gonna use KVB, Hayes (the DE) and Ball, you have MORE than enough rotation at DT and could use our best pass rushing DE's. While Kearse is not a great pass rusher anymore, he's been better than KVB and against a team that likes to run stretch run plays and take deep drops, Kearse would be a good guy to have available...especially over a Marks.

    In an all hands on deck game...deactivating Kearse was a terrible move and why I think there is something ELSE to this story.

    Teams play their best players unless they have a great reason not to or there is a problem. I think there is a problem. What? I have no idea. But also, the fact of Fisher deactivating him and him not being on the sidelines and NOT getting fined seem to also indicate there was a problem that Fisher is keeping between he and Jevon. Perhaps the Titans decided to start Hayes and Kearse freaked out and didn't want to play. Who knows...

    Well...

    According to Fisher, they decided to keep Dave Ball up instead of Kearse because they had decided to use some DE's at the DT spot and Ball has done that and Kearse hasn't. The Titans did in fact use KVB and Hayes at DT here and there. JF apparently understood telling Kearse 9 minutes before kickoff that not only wasn't he gonna start but wasn't even gonna be active - would be upsetting.
